Coppa Italia 2025/26
The Stadio Olimpico crackled with anticipation as Lazio hosted Inter in a crucial Coppa Italia clash. Both sides fielded strong lineups, signaling their intent to progress in the prestigious competition. The air was thick with the promise of tactical battles and individual brilliance.
Lazio aimed to disrupt Inter's rhythm with an energetic pressing game, attempting to force turnovers in dangerous areas. Their 42% possession suggests a willingness to cede the ball at times, focusing on quick transitions and utilizing the flanks. The home side registered 74 attacks, indicating a proactive approach, though their final product saw limited success with only 0.73 expected goals. Inter, conversely, looked to build play methodically, moving the ball between their lines to find openings.
The defensive structures were largely effective in the opening exchanges, with both teams limiting clear-cut opportunities. Inter's ability to control possession and advance into the opposition half was evident in their passing statistics. Lazio's defense, marshalled by Romagnoli and Gila, worked diligently to stifle Inter's forward forays. The midfield battle was intense, with players like Barella and Zieliński looking to dictate play for the visitors against a determined Lazio midfield.
As the match progressed, the intensity remained high, with both teams creating moments of promise. Lazio's attacking efforts, while persistent, struggled to break down Inter's solid defensive shape, evidenced by their 0.46 expected assists. The Nerazzurri, meanwhile, sought to exploit spaces with their dynamic forwards, aiming to convert their own attacking sequences into tangible threats. The game became a tense affair, with neither side willing to concede ground easily.
Key passes from both teams hinted at potential breakthroughs, but the final execution often fell short. Lazio's 74 attacks and 2 shots on target reflect their efforts to find the back of the net, but the 0.73 expected goals figure suggests efficiency was an issue. Inter, while perhaps not dominating possession, possessed the quality to create danger. The match remained a tight contest, a testament to the defensive organization and the fine margins at this level of competition.
The final whistle would eventually signal the outcome of this closely fought Coppa Italia encounter. Both teams showcased their strengths and weaknesses, providing a compelling tactical spectacle. The pressure of the knockout stage was palpable, with every pass and tackle carrying significant weight in the quest for progression.
